IT Support Specialist

PFNonwovens LLC, Hazleton, Pennsylvania, United States, 18202


Principal Accountabilities/ Responsibilities:

•Proficient troubleshooting abilities and attention to detail.•Increase business efficiency through IT-enabled process improvement using existing tools as well as hardware and software resources.•Ensure data security and integrity at the employee, application, and facility level following enterprise-wide defined policy and practice.•Align local IT resources, shared resources with business unit objectives•Create competitive advantage through IT by enabling process improvements focused on the business unit's speed, efficiency, quality, and agility.•Manage network equipment and keep service secure and upgraded. Ensure effectiveness and compliance.•Ability and desire to engage with all functions of the business unit and associated processes to understand and articulate the business requirements as well as the IT capabilities and requirements.

•Ability to manage priorities and deliver results with limited resources.•Ability and desire to be hands on with applications and technology tools to deliver solutions.•Problem solving and decision-making skills.•Track help desk tickets and service requests.•Analyze and trouble shoot hardware, software and security access requests, including PC's, laptops, business unit application and site servers, and media devices•Upgrade PC hardware and software, including but not limited to hard drives, memory, peripheral devices, operating systems, application software•New employee computer set up and handling of repair to existing equipment.•Cover all business unit location I.T. service needs as necessary Support shared services endeavors for the business unit on projects and as remote hands including thin clients, Citrix and application servers, facilities security, and networking•Support and enablement of Exchange based resources including calendars, rooms, equipment•Enable and support of departmental, project based, public, and private collaboration resources including folders and SharePoint areas.•Document procedures and assist in educating and training the user community•Ensure full customer satisfaction.

Education and experience requirements:

•Associate's degree in computer science or above, desired.•CompTIA A+ or MCDA Certifications a plus•3 or more years of progressive experience in the desk side support arena.

Work Environment:

Manufacturing and Office environment

Physical Requirements:

Manufacturing and Office environmentMust be able to walk the facility for the duration of the shiftMay need to grasp, hold, carry, lift, crawl, kneel, squat occasionally during ShiftMay need to climb without issue with heights up to three (3) levelsWithstand temperature changes between high temperatures and moderate to low temperaturesHearing protection, safety glasses, safety shoes and hard hat required in designated areas
